**14:22 — Kiosk watchdog goes rogue.** Quick context for folks new to the Ordello kiosks: each unit runs a watchdog that reboots the shell app if it stops heartbeating. Today the watchdog itself hung, so kiosks at the Brinmore lobby sat on a frozen splash screen for ~40 minutes with nobody getting rebooted. Tam spotted it from the fleet dashboard and pushed a manual restart wave. We're adding a watchdog-for-the-watchdog (yes, really). The stuck firmware build is identified by the token below.

session token of bagag-fafop = htk21_cbc501024a787b9031ac6

It reads images from a watched directory, applies the configured resize profiles, and writes outputs to a sandboxed path. For security review purposes, note that all file-path handling, the sanitization of user-supplied profile names, and the dependency pinning policy are maintained by a single accountable owner. All findings, including those rated low severity, should be routed to that owner directly. The full name of the responsible engineer appears below.

account owner for fajep-yagef: Kasix Eliiel

To the release manager: I'm passing ownership of the Pellwick deep-link router to Sorrel before the 4.2 cut. The intent-matching table now lives in the Farrowgate config service; stale entries were purged last sprint. Watch the fallback route — it silently swallows malformed slugs, which inflated our drop-off metrics in March. The staging resolver needs its keystore unlocked before each regression pass, and that keystore accepts only one credential. For the signing vault, the recovery phrase is noted directly below.

recovery phrase for tafog-fafog: novix-novdor-fraath-brieth-olieth-oliix-rusix-wenion-julax-druox